Diamond exploration firm Karelian has announced positive results from a sampling programme at its Riihivaara target in eastern Finland which point towards the existence of a diamoniferous kimberlite pipe in the area.

The programme resulted in the discovery of 12 garnet indicator minerals, which are used to locate kimberlite, a type of volcanic rock which can contain diamonds. Chairman Richard Conroy welcomed the "positive indicators".
